Subaru Crosstrek Service Manual: Removal

INTAKE (INDUCTION)(H4DO) > Air Cleaner Element

REMOVAL

1. Disconnect the ground cable from battery. NOTE">

2. Remove the air intake duct. Air Intake Duct > REMOVAL">

3. Disconnect the connector (A) from the mass air flow and intake air temperature sensor, and remove the clip (B).

4. Loosen the clamp (A) which secures the air intake boot to the air cleaner case (rear), and then remove the clip (B) from the air cleaner case (front).

5. Remove the air cleaner case (rear) and air cleaner element.
